Shasta Cottage, A romantic get-away in Mt. Shasta.
Beautiful, quiet and romantic!!! This craftsman style cabin has gorgeous wood floors, wood trimmed windows, custom built kitchen with stainless appliances and stone backdrop. River rock touches, private bedroom with elegant bath filled with light. Its cozy yet elegant and woodsy all together. Quality furniture and bedding, strong internet and cable TV on smart-tv. Light front porch and private back deck. Main home next door is rented separately or can be rented together.

From the photos we thought this would be a quaint little cottage in the woods at the edge of town. It's a cute older cottage with beautiful wood floors and many original features. Unfortunately, somewhere in its history there were occupants who were heavy smokers. The smell was obvious and unpleasant for us. It is an older home in a sometimes damp environment, so an expected musty smell was also present. Fortunately, there are lots of windows and doors that opened so we were able to air it out a bit. It was well appointed with nice furniture, remodeled bathroom, and very comfortable king size bed with lots of cozy bedding. The kitchen could use a deep cleaning. The view out two sides of the cottage is wonderful, and the back deck is quiet, peaceful and private. The front overlooks the messy construction area of the home next to cottage. The driveway in front of the cottage was partially blocked with building materials and equipment which we had to navigate around to get in and out. The neighboring lot is a commercial wood lot and under construction, so the view from the front porch was disappointing. We were there over a weekend, but Monday morning brought construction workers in the front yard and activity at the wood lot. We wanted to love this cottage, but in spite of its many positives, we disappointed. I'm sure it would work well for others, just not us.
